Take a photo of a barcode or cover
01 Jan 2025—31 Dec 2025
Overview
Challenge Books
All books added
1 hour, 56 minutes • audio • 2024 (editions)
ISBN/UID: 9781668116715
Format: Audio
Language: English
Original Pub Year: 2024
Edition Pub Date: 19 November 2024
Publisher: Simon & Schuster Audio
Browse Editions1 hour, 56 minutes • audio • 2024
ISBN/UID: 9781668116715
Format: Audio
Language: English
Original Pub Year: 2024
Edition Pub Date: 19 November 2024
Publisher: Simon & Schuster Audio
Browse Editions384 pages • hardcover • 2023 (editions)
ISBN/UID: 9783550202414
Format: Hardcover
Language: German
Original Pub Year: 2023
Edition Pub Date: 28 September 2023
Publisher: Ullstein
Browse Editions384 pages • hardcover • 2023
ISBN/UID: 9783550202414
Format: Hardcover
Language: German
Original Pub Year: 2023
Edition Pub Date: 28 September 2023
Publisher: Ullstein
Browse Editions280 pages • paperback • 2017 (editions)
ISBN/UID: 9781849352604
Format: Paperback
Language: English
Original Pub Year: 2017
Edition Pub Date: 18 April 2017
Publisher: AK Press
Browse Editions280 pages • paperback • 2017
ISBN/UID: 9781849352604
Format: Paperback
Language: English
Original Pub Year: 2017
Edition Pub Date: 18 April 2017
Publisher: AK Press
Browse Editions320 pages • digital • 2018 (editions)
ISBN/UID: 9781501181801
Format: Digital
Language: English
Original Pub Year: 2018
Edition Pub Date: 02 October 2018
Publisher: Simon & Schuster
Browse Editions320 pages • digital • 2018
ISBN/UID: 9781501181801
Format: Digital
Language: English
Original Pub Year: 2018
Edition Pub Date: 02 October 2018
Publisher: Simon & Schuster
Browse Editions377 pages • paperback • 2021 (editions)
ISBN/UID: 9780571357628
Format: Paperback
Language: English
Original Pub Year: 2021
Edition Pub Date: 30 June 2022
Publisher: Faber & Faber
Browse Editions377 pages • paperback • 2021
ISBN/UID: 9780571357628
Format: Paperback
Language: English
Original Pub Year: 2021
Edition Pub Date: 30 June 2022
Publisher: Faber & Faber
Browse Editions265 pages • hardcover • 2010 (editions)
ISBN/UID: 9781414333076
Format: Hardcover
Language: English
Original Pub Year: 2010
Edition Pub Date: Not specified
Publisher: SaltRiver
Browse Editions265 pages • hardcover • 2010
ISBN/UID: 9781414333076
Format: Hardcover
Language: English
Original Pub Year: 2010
Edition Pub Date: Not specified
Publisher: SaltRiver
Browse Editions432 pages • hardcover • 2020 (editions)
ISBN/UID: 9780385534079
Format: Hardcover
Language: English
Original Pub Year: 2020
Edition Pub Date: 17 March 2020
Publisher: Doubleday Books
Browse Editions432 pages • hardcover • 2020
ISBN/UID: 9780385534079
Format: Hardcover
Language: English
Original Pub Year: 2020
Edition Pub Date: 17 March 2020
Publisher: Doubleday Books
Browse Editions384 pages • hardcover • 2023 (editions)
ISBN/UID: 9780593655269
Format: Hardcover
Language: English
Original Pub Year: 2023
Edition Pub Date: 17 October 2023
Publisher: Penguin Press
Browse Editions384 pages • hardcover • 2023
ISBN/UID: 9780593655269
Format: Hardcover
Language: English
Original Pub Year: 2023
Edition Pub Date: 17 October 2023
Publisher: Penguin Press
Browse Editions372 pages • paperback • 2017 (editions)
ISBN/UID: 9780715652992
Format: Paperback
Language: English
Original Pub Year: 2017
Edition Pub Date: Not specified
Publisher: Duckworth Overlook
Browse Editions372 pages • paperback • 2017
ISBN/UID: 9780715652992
Format: Paperback
Language: English
Original Pub Year: 2017
Edition Pub Date: Not specified
Publisher: Duckworth Overlook
Browse Editions336 pages • paperback • 2019 (editions)
ISBN/UID: 9781781089026
Format: Paperback
Language: English
Original Pub Year: 2019
Edition Pub Date: 05 March 2019
Publisher: Solaris
Browse Editions336 pages • paperback • 2019
ISBN/UID: 9781781089026
Format: Paperback
Language: English
Original Pub Year: 2019
Edition Pub Date: 05 March 2019
Publisher: Solaris
Browse Editions